The shape of the leaves are a easy way to identify iris. They look like swords and go all the way to the bottom. Tulips have their leaves higher on the stem. The number of petals is another way. Iris has three petals and three smaller sepals.

This are data that has four measurement width length petals and sepals of the 3 species of IRIS.?

The dataset you are referring to likely includes measurements of the width and length of petals and sepals for three species of Iris flowers: Iris setosa, Iris versicolor, and Iris virginica. These measurements are commonly used in data analysis and machine learning to classify the species based on their physical characteristics. The dataset is often utilized in educational settings for teaching concepts in statistics, data visualization, and classification algorithms. It serves as a classic example in the field of pattern recognition.


What are the little lines in the iris of the eye?

The little lines in the iris of the eye are known as iris crypts or furrows. They are natural characteristics of the iris and vary in size and shape from person to person. These crypts help determine the unique pattern of the iris, which is used in biometric identification.

Is an iris considered a monocot plant?

Yes, an iris is considered a monocot plant. Monocots have seeds with only one cotyledon (seed leaf) and typically have parallel veined leaves, and the iris fits these characteristics.
